|
@@ -602,8 +602,10 @@ public class ApsProcessOperationProcessEquServiceImpl extends ServiceImpl<ApsPro
|
|
|
*/
|
|
|
//工序作业ID
|
|
|
String processid = apsProcessOperationProcessEquDo.getProcessid();
|
|
|
+ //查询工序作业详情
|
|
|
+ ApsProcessOperationDo apsProcessOperationDo = apsProcessOperationService.getById(processid);
|
|
|
//查询工艺步骤指定的可选设备
|
|
|
- List<String> processOperationEquList = this.baseMapper.selectEquByProcessId(processid);
|
|
|
+ List<String> processOperationEquList = Arrays.asList(apsProcessOperationDo.getCanchoosedeviceid().split(","));
|
|
|
// List<ApsProcessOperationEquDo> processOperationEquDos = apsProcessOperationEquService.list(new LambdaQueryWrapper<ApsProcessOperationEquDo>().eq(ApsProcessOperationEquDo::getMainid, processid));
|
|
|
long count = processOperationEquList.stream().filter(item -> item.equals(apsProcessOperationProcessEquDo.getProcessdeviceid())).count();
|
|
|
String newConflictdes = apsProcessOperationProcessEquDo.getConflictdes();
|
|
@@ -617,8 +619,8 @@ public class ApsProcessOperationProcessEquServiceImpl extends ServiceImpl<ApsPro
|
|
|
apsProcessOperationProcessEquDo.getProcessdeviceid(), NO_NEED_EQU, 2, null);
|
|
|
newConflictdes = removeConflictsDesc(newConflictdes, NO_NEED_EQU);
|
|
|
}
|
|
|
- //查询工序作业详情
|
|
|
- ApsProcessOperationDo apsProcessOperationDo = apsProcessOperationService.getById(apsProcessOperationProcessEquDo.getProcessid());
|
|
|
+// //查询工序作业详情
|
|
|
+// ApsProcessOperationDo apsProcessOperationDo = apsProcessOperationService.getById(apsProcessOperationProcessEquDo.getProcessid());
|
|
|
|
|
|
//存在前道工序作业明细
|
|
|
if (StringUtils.isNotBlank(apsProcessOperationProcessEquDo.getPreviousprocessesids())) {
|